Seasonal timing and what to expect from Saint-Germain-sur-Ay

Normandy experiences a temperate maritime climate, with warm summers ideal for beach days and mild shoulder seasons that are perfect for hiking, cycling, and light outdoor adventures. If you’re seeking a balance between outdoor activity and quieter moments with friends, late spring and early autumn offer comfortable temperatures and fewer crowds, which can be ideal for a more intimate glamping tent experience.

Summer brings longer days, vibrant market stalls, and the opportunity to experience coastal hospitality at its best. If you’re coordinating a group trip, the peak season might require a bit more planning for accommodations and activities, but it also delivers a lively atmosphere with festivals, live music, and evening markets along the coast. Autumn can be a magical time, too, with russet sunsets and harvest flavors debuting at local eateries and markets.
